Course Details
• Advanced Bioinformatics Algorithms: This unit covers the complex algorithms used in bioinformatics, including sequence alignment, pattern searching, and data analysis methods.
• Machine Learning in Bioinformatics: This unit explores the application of machine learning techniques in bioinformatics, including supervised and unsupervised learning, deep learning, and neural networks.
• Smart Systems for Genomics Data Analysis: This unit delves into the use of smart systems for analyzing genomic data, including next-generation sequencing (NGS) data, genome assembly, and variant calling.
• Protein Structure Prediction: This unit covers the methods and techniques used to predict protein structure, including homology modeling, ab initio methods, and molecular dynamics simulations.
• Biological Network Analysis: This unit explores the analysis of biological networks, including gene regulatory networks, protein-protein interaction networks, and metabolic networks.
• Big Data Analytics in Bioinformatics: This unit covers the use of big data analytics in bioinformatics, including data management, data processing, and data visualization.
• Cloud Computing for Bioinformatics: This unit explores the use of cloud computing in bioinformatics, including the benefits and challenges of cloud computing, and the tools and platforms available for bioinformatics analysis in the cloud.
• Artificial Intelligence in Bioinformatics: This unit covers the application of artificial intelligence techniques in bioinformatics, including natural language processing, computer vision, and robotics.
• Biomedical Image Analysis: This unit explores the use of image analysis techniques in bioinformatics, including image segmentation, registration, and classification.
